Output faf09da78e23886b133d3c593ea1390fbdc1656c8bfa706269becbcfd03be4a8:0

value
1104042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95f671032cc8644015b3d1a2db2c3076e8459cb5 OP_EQUAL
address
3FMwqBLE9DsFbdWBsZRqhsMWeZ27Vsehxo
transaction
faf09da78e23886b133d3c593ea1390fbdc1656c8bfa706269becbcfd03be4a8
spent
true